Tips for Effective Walkthrough



Taking a look at a specialist's previous work provides valuable understandings into their abilities and suitability for your task. When conducting a walkthrough of their past tasks, keep these pointers in mind for a reliable analysis.

Firstly, focus on the general quality of the work. Try to find indications of craftsmanship, interest to information, and using high-grade products. Evaluate if the projects straighten with your standards and vision.

Secondly, evaluate the functionality of the finished projects. Examine if the styles are useful, efficient, and fulfill the demands of the customers. This analysis can provide you an idea of how well the specialist converts ideas into functional structures.

Additionally, observe the timeline and adherence to routines in their past projects. Hold-ups can be expensive and troublesome, so make sure that the specialist has a record of completing work with time.
